Finding happiness, or at least contentment, often requires changing your daily thoughts and behaviors, and those happen to be the two elements of personality. Psychological research suggests that agency—the sense that you can create a positive difference in the world, or at least in your life—is linked to reduced levels of depression and helplessness. “Agency causes progress,” the positive-psychology pioneer Martin Seligman has said, while “lack of agency causes stagnation.” Agency imbues you with the sense that you can do something about your problems.
